Windows Server: Recommendations for installation and maintenance?

I have a client who is set to switch from a Linux/Apache combo to a Windows server. The timing is tricky because I’m in the middle of a proposal to move their site from a static one to a Textpattern-run site.

I’d like to be able to convince the execs that the Windows switch is just a bad idea and move on from there with the existing server, but I need more information for that. Their IT guy didn’t seem to have any idea if he could get PHP/MySQL to work on the new server and I’m no IT professional.

Then, as a fall back I need to be able to get TXP running on their new server if they proceed in that direction. I’ll also be maintaining the site myself so I’ll need to know any big hang ups that can happen going that route too.

So I need two things:

  1. Resources which discuss Linux vs Windows in terms of PHP/MySQL, advantages and disadvantages of each, possibly even costs associated with running TXP on a Windows server, security issues, etc.
  2. Resources and tips on how to work with a Windows server and TXP both for installation and future maintenance of the site, problems to look out for, that sort of thing.
